Solar CCTV cameras are a great way to keep an eye on your property without having to worry about power outages or running up your electric bill. But how do they work?
Solar CCTV cameras rely on solar panels to convert sunlight into electricity. This electricity is then used to power the camera and its components. Solar CCTV cameras typically have a backup battery that kicks in when there is not enough sunlight to power the camera. This ensures that you can still keep an eye on your property, even when the sun isn’t shining.

What Are The Benefits Of Using A Solar Cctv Camera?

There are many benefits of using a solar CCTV camera over a traditional CCTV camera. Solar CCTV cameras are powered by solar panels, so they don’t need to be connected to an external power source. This means that they can be placed almost anywhere, even in remote or difficult-to-reach places. Solar CCTV cameras are also very low maintenance, as they don’t need to be regularly serviced or replaced like traditional CCTV cameras.
Another benefit of solar CCTV cameras is that they are environmentally friendly. Solar power is a renewable resource, so using solar CCTV cameras helps to reduce our reliance on fossil fuels. Solar CCTV cameras also don’t produce any emissions, so they don’t contribute to air pollution.

Are There Any Disadvantages To Using A Solar Cctv Camera?

Although solar CCTV cameras are becoming increasingly popular, there are a few potential disadvantages to consider before installation. Solar CCTV cameras rely on sunlight to power the camera, which means that they may not be able to function properly or at all during extended periods of cloudy or rainy weather. Additionally, solar CCTV cameras are typically more expensive than traditional CCTV cameras.
